Can someone answer me a simple question...
 
Why did the authors of software that allows the apache to be customized name it 'kitchen' ? That and other badly named references like Helmi this and helmi that, AKU, etc needed when trying to upgrade the OS on the HTC apache makes it amazingly hard for the learning newbie...

Re: Can someone answer me a simple question...
 
it's called a kitchen as far as i understand it because you throw in your ingredients and and out pops a customized "cooked" rom

as far as helmi goes he's the creator of the original wm6 apache rom and kitchen base kit

It might also help to know that Windows Mobile is the operating system but it is sold to wireless carriers that "modify" it to work on their systems. That is the AKU upgrade business, e.g. Verizon has provided a sanctioned update for the XV6700 but other carriers may not have any ROM updates. The 6700 is "end of life" and not supported anymore with ROM updates. That is why the kitchens were developed, so that we could get WM6 and 6.1 on our phones.
